Output 73d156c52382ce1301c1770189c7557f477b40c4b7a836ae3a62ef3741e4477a:1

value
29471
script pubkey
OP_0 OP_PUSHBYTES_20 4be7ebf9db5933484275834efc470e4620d7dde5
address
bc1qf0n7h7wmtye5ssn4sd80c3cwgcsd0h09kx0an9
transaction
73d156c52382ce1301c1770189c7557f477b40c4b7a836ae3a62ef3741e4477a
spent
true